Washburn logoWU No. 15 in AVCA Poll

Sept. 28, 2004 - The Washburn Lady Blues volleyball team moved up two spots to No. 15 in the AVCA Division II Top 25 Poll, which was released Tuesday. The No. 15 ranking is Washburn's highest mark in school history. The Lady Blues were ranked No. 17 last week, which was their previous best ranking.
The Lady Blues, who are 17-1 overall for the first time in school history and 5-1 in the MIAA, travel to No. 9 Central Missouri State 7 p.m. tonight. The Lady Blues and Jennies are tied for second in the MIAA behind No. 3 Truman State.
